Ismayilli weather in August

In August, Ismayilli sees average daytime highs of 27°C and overnight lows near 17°C, with 38 mm of rain across 5.5 wet days and about 13.6 hours of daylight. It is the 2nd-warmest and 11th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 28°C in the first days to 25°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 70% of the time in August,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 14 h 12 min at the start of August to 13 hours by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, August is Ismayilli's 1st-clearest and 3rd-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Ismayilli's year-round climate.

Temperature in August

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s ease over the month, from about 28°C in the first days to 25°C by the end.

A typical August day in Ismayilli reaches about 27°C in the afternoon and slips back to 17°C overnight — a 10°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 22°C and 31°C. Set against its neighbours, August runs on par with July and about 5°C warmer than September.

Cloud cover in August

ClearMostly clearPartly cloudyMostly cloudyOvercast

The sky is clear or mostly clear about 70% of the time in August, the clearest month of the year.

Beyond those clear spells, partly cloudy skies cover about 14% of August, with mostly cloudy or overcast conditions the remaining 16%.

Sunrise & sunset in August

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 14 h 12 min at the start of August to 13 hours by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days shrink by about 72 minutes over August. Sunrise moves from 5:47 AM to 6:18 AM, and sunset from 7:59 PM to 7:17 PM.

Location & terrain

Where is Ismayilli?

Ismayilli sits at 40.8°N, 48.2°E, 579 m above sea level, in Azerbaijan. The nearest listed city is Aghsu, 32 km away.

Topography around Ismayilli

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Ismayilli.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Ismayilli has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 191 m around an average of 607 m above sea level; within 16 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,090 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 4,438 m.

The land around Ismayilli is covered by cropland (40%), trees (26%) and artificial surfaces (21%) within 3 km, trees (52%) and cropland (23%) within 16 km, and grassland (36%), cropland (28%) and trees (20%) within 80 km.
